Beschreibung
Zusammenfassung:Lustick et al talk about the Arab-Israeli conflict. Roughly 15,000 Israelis have died in this conflict, and about 55,000 Palestinians. The odds were always against the two-state solution's success, whether because of the crippling hold that a bunkered Israel lobby has on American policy in the region, the Islamicization of politics in the Arab world, or a cultural transformation of the Israeli political landscape driven by decades of siege, Holocaust mania and triumphalism.
